Propulsion-Force Optimized Control of Linear Induction Motor for Urban Transportation System Considering Material Change of Reaction Plate

Abstract:

In this paper, a method of calculating the parameters of equivalent circuit model of linear induction motor(LIM) is proposed based on numerical analysis and finite element method(FEM). The method is proved accurately through the traditional removed and locked method. Material change of reaction plate’s effect on how equivalent circuit’s parameters change and the influence on control characteristics are analyzed through this method. A control algorithm to compensate the effect of material change is presented. The compensation is based on equivalent circuit parameters variation and indirect vector control. Simulation results have shown the algorithm had good performances
